The Role of Blockchain in Property Management

Blockchain technology, often regarded as the backbone of cryptocurrencies, also plays a pivotal role in revolutionizing property management. Think of blockchain as a digital ledger, much like a bank vault for your assets.

  • Transparency: All transactions are recorded publicly on the blockchain, allowing for unmatched transparency.
  • Security: Using the latest tiêu chuẩn an ninh blockchain, property transactions are safeguarded against fraud.
  • Efficiency: Smart contracts automate and simplify complex processes, reducing the time and cost associated with traditional methods.
